Publisher Description:

I am a Roman emperor, and my empire stretches from the sunny Mediterranean to northern Europe. I can tell that you're impressed. There are several rules I follow to keep everything under control: It is my right to banish traitors to freezing Britain. I will conquer lands to gain riches--and more people to pay taxes and work for me. My buildings must be beautifully made with the best materials. And by the way, I'm pretty generous. I declare public holidays and allow my people to watch gladiator fights. You must agree, this is a brilliant plan to keep my empire strong. What could possibly go wrong?


Contributor Bio(s): Chambers, Catherine: -

Catherine Chambers was born in Adelaide, South Australia, and brought up in England. She has written about 130 titles for children and young adults, and enjoys seeking out intriguing facts for her nonfiction titles.
